Dashing like a Warrior
Yesterday Chris, my sister and I ran our second Warrior Dash! Well, it was my sister’s first Warrior Dash and first race ever! The Warrior Dash is a 3.2 mile mud run with a bunch of different obstacles scattered throughout the course.
Our wave was at 11:30, so we got ready and headed to the start.
The start, which includes a 1.5 mile climb straight up Windham Mountain.
The course was almost the same as last year, except there were a few more obstacles in the first 1.5 miles. Last time they were at the top of the mountain and more as you were going down.
